The time it will take for the investment to grow to $4500 is 11.97 years
The formula for calculating the compound interest is expressed according to the formula
P(t) = P(1+r/n)^nt
Given the following parameters
P0 = $3000
rate = 3.4%
time = t
P(t) = 4500
n = 4
Substitute
4500 = 3000(1+0.034/4)^4t
45/30 = 1.0085^4t
1.5 = 1.0085^4t
ln1.5 = 4tln1.0085
4t = ln1.5/ln1.0085
4t = 47.904
t = 11.97
Hence the time it will take for the investment to grow to $4500 is 11.97 years
